9X82-B
The WinGD 9X82-B is a high‑power, low‑speed 2‑stroke marine diesel engine delivering up to 46 MW at 79 rpm, noted for its wide power‑speed range and flexible fuel capability.

Common issues
- cylinder liner wear or scuffing
- piston ring wear or sticking in the groove
- exhaust valve spindle/seat burning or wear
- turbocharger fouling reducing efficiency and increasing exhaust temperature
- fuel injection equipment wear affecting cylinder balance
- crosshead and crankpin bearing wear
- scavenge space oil/carbon deposit buildup (fire risk)
Inspection checklist
- measure cylinder liner wear with a bore gauge
- inspect piston rings and ring grooves at overhaul
- check exhaust valve spindle and seat condition
- inspect turbocharger blades and nozzle ring for fouling and erosion
- check crosshead and crankpin bearing clearances
- inspect scavenge space for oil/carbon deposits
- verify fuel injection equipment condition and calibration
- review cylinder drain oil analysis trends
Service intervals
| Cylinder liner wear measurement | typically every 8,000-12,000 running hours or per the maker's PMS - confirm against the engine manual |
| Piston overhaul (ring renewal/inspection) | typically every 12,000-24,000 hours depending on fuel and lube oil quality |
| Exhaust valve overhaul | typically every 8,000-16,000 hours |
| Turbocharger overhaul | per maker's schedule, typically every 12,000-24,000 hours |
| Crankshaft deflection check | at each major survey/dry-dock |
Typical wear limits
| Cylinder liner wear | engines of this class are typically reassessed or renewed in the region of 0.6-1.0% of bore diameter wear - confirm the exact figure against WinGD's maker's manual, as it varies by liner design |
| Crankpin/main bearing clearance | compare against the maker's stated new and maximum allowable clearance for this engine rather than a generic figure |
Ranges are typical for this design class. Always confirm against the manufacturer documentation for your serial number.
Critical spares
- piston rings
- cylinder liners
- exhaust valve spindles and seats
- fuel injection valves
- cylinder lubricator quills
- turbocharger bearing cartridges
Safety
- crankcase/scavenge space explosion risk from oil mist ignition
- high-pressure fuel system injury risk
- hot exhaust and turbocharger surfaces
- heavy component lifting during overhaul (pistons, liners)
- starting air system pressure hazard
Class survey
WinGD X82 engines fall under Continuous Survey Machinery; class typically reviews crankshaft deflection records, cylinder condition reports, turbocharger overhaul history and IMO Tier compliance documentation at each survey.
